How do I connect Modbus devices to my C-Bus Controller?

Hide Show

The C-Bus Controller supports Modbus RS485 and Modbus TCP/IP connections; however, you need to verify that the communication parameters such as Parity & Modbus Address are set correctly

What is the default IP Address of the C-Bus Controller's USB-B Port?

Hide Show

When connected using a USB-A to USB-B cable, you can access the controller's internal web server by:

1. Open a supported browser

2. Entering in the IP Address: 192.168.254.10 (default - does not change)

 

USB Image

How is the C-Bus Controller Powered?

Hide Show

The C-Bus Controllers can be temporarily powered using a USB-A to USB-B cable via the USB-B port on the front of the controller; however, this only provides limited functionality.

 

For full functionality the C-Bus Controllers require 24VDC

How can I check that my C-Bus Controller has access to the internet

Hide Show

Under Configurator > System > Status > Network Utility

1

 

Type google.com in to the IP/Hostname field

2

If successful you will see package transmit and receive

How to upgrade firmware for the SpaceLogic C-Bus Controllers?

Hide Show
How to upgrade firmware for the SpaceLogic C-Bus Controllers?

The SpaceLogic C-Bus Controllers are 5500NAC2, 5500AC2, 5500NAC, 5500SHAC, LSS5500NAC, LSS5500SHAC.

Upgrade firmware
Access to the Configurator page and System page
The path: Configurator Utility tab → System button → System tab → Upgrade firmware
Click Choose File button and select the firmware file (5500NAC2_Firmware_V1.15.0.img)
SpaceLogic C-Bus Controller firmware upgrading.PNG

Note:
  • Do not switch off the Controller during the installation.
  • Clean the browser cache after the installation. Use the settings in your browser or the short cuts [Crtl] + [N] or [Crtl] + [F5].

Is there any software used to program 5500AC2 / 5500NAC2?

Hide Show

Unfortunately no there is no software, it’s program via a web browser and requires the actual hardware to do so.

 

 A browser such as Google Chrome, Safari or Firefox is a prerequisite for operation.

 

You can use a bench test unit to build the project. It can then be Backed up and Restore on to the unit onsite.
